Live Your Dream in Venice's Premier 55+ Boating Community where you can have a home for you and your boat. It is less than 10 min by boat to the Gulf of Mexico (America). You can travel by the Intracoastal or Gulf of Mexico north to Sarasota or South to Englewood and enjoy many waterfront dining choices. Slips are available to rent at very affordable price. The home is walking distance to the grocery store, liquor store, restaurants, and more. This double wide home appears bigger in person than the recorded sq ft portrays. Come take a look to see if it suits your needs. There is a lot of bang for your buck here. Don't miss out. The home has been completely updated and replumbed. It features an open floor plan with a brand new kitchen, modernized bath, fresh flooring, new paint, and stylish window coverings. Outside, enjoy a newly constructed carport with covered parking for two cars, plus an extended driveway for additional space. Relax on the inviting front porch, complete with a new roof and posts. Plus, there's a brand-new shed for extra storage or workshop space, making it even easier to keep everything organized. All of this can be yours at an affordable priceâ€â€don’t miss out on this incredible opportunity! Furnishings are Optional! Are you ready to embrace the lifestyle you've always dreamed of? This vibrant, resident-owned boating community offers endless opportunities for recreation and relaxation, including boating, biking, fishing, tennis, pickleball, billiards, ping pong, shuffleboard, and so much more. In addition to the outdoor fun, you'll find a fully equipped fitness center, library, sewing room, and a ceramics & pottery studio with kiln. Located along the Intracoastal Waterway on the beautiful island of Venice, FL, this updated home is part of the island’s best active 55+ community, complete with its own marina and easy access to the bike trail. Just one mile to the beach. It is just minutes from the airport, golf course, excellent waterfront dining and shopping, this home combines the best of both convenience and coastal living. It's even walking distance to the grocery store, liquor store and a few restaurants/sports bar. The driveway is long enough to accommodate 3 vehicles even though you don't need one.   • Tatiana I.
    "A piece of paradise. Everything is in walking and biking distance. The island has everything from parks, local restaurants, beaches, the jetty, festivals, a library, an art center, a local museum, city basketball, tennis, pickleball, and shuffleboard courts, a children's splash pad, churches, a hospital, and a grocery store. It also has and elementary, middle, and high school where kids can bike to school. At the downtown gazebo there are public concerts and there are often downtown festivals. Every Saturday there's a farmer's market in front of the firehouse. It's golf cart and bike friendly with the famous legacy trail bike trail. You can visit the public beaches, fish from the city pier or jetty, or venture out for an isolated stroll along Casperson's beach, known as the shark's tooth capital of the world. Botique shops, ice cream shops, and local restraunts provide plenty to do year round. Perfect for families or retires. "

  • Patricia L.
    "I’ve lived on Venice Island for four years. I love how people always acknowledge each other with a cheerful greeting. And I love having a supermarket, drug store, banks, post office, restaurants, art and exercise classes, theatrical and musical performances, and the beach all within easy walking distance. A very strong sense of community, with fun holiday parades and festivals throughout the year. Dogs are welcome at sidewalk cafes and there’s even a dedicated Dog Beach where dogs can run free and swim."
